Subject: Cut-over complete — Relqueue retired

Team,

As of Tuesday night, the homegrown job queue (Relqueue) has been fully replaced by Dispatchline across all Norvale environments. Workers drained cleanly, and no jobs were lost during the switch. New hires: you no longer need Relqueue credentials or its admin panel. All enqueue calls now go through the Dispatchline client library. The production service runs with the following configuration values.

deployment values, yafop-tahof:
HOLIX_HOST=holix.zemvarsys.internal
HOLIX_PORT=3306

## Runbook: slimming images with TrimForge

Welcome aboard! We keep our container images lean with TrimForge, which strips build tools, docs, and unused locales after the final build stage. Rule of thumb: if the slimmed image exceeds 180 MB, something snuck in — usually a debug package someone forgot to remove. Run the analyzer before pushing, and never disable the layer squash step, even if it's slow. TrimForge reads its behavior from the settings below.

config for kawif-hahig:
zorix:
  log_level: error
  metrics_host: metrics.zorix.lumiclabs.internal
  pool_size: 16

Q: How does Quillport retry failed webhook deliveries? A: We retry with exponential backoff up to eight attempts, then park the event in the dead-letter store. Replaying parked events requires the ops recovery account on the Quillport console. To unlock that account, use the recovery passphrase given immediately below.

recovery phrase for fajep-yaweg: gilath-sorox-wenius-rusdor-keliel-zorius